Definitions from Wiktionary (granny)
▸ noun: (colloquial) A grandmother.
▸ noun: (colloquial) Any elderly woman, regardless of if she has grandchildren.
▸ noun: (knots) A granny knot.
▸ noun: (agriculture, colloquial) An older ewe that may lure a lamb away from its mother.
▸ adjective: (informal) typically or stereotypically old-fashioned, especially in clothing and accessories worn by or associated with elderly women.
▸ verb: (informal, intransitive) To be a grandmother.
▸ verb: (informal, intransitive) To act like a stereotypical grandmother; to fuss.
▸ noun: (Australia, colloquial) A grand final.
